Which two factors determine the density of seawater?

Geography
1 answer:
Nikitich [7]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

I would go with A. Salinity and Temperature

What is the name of the area represented in red that was the site of the chernobyl nuclear accident in 1986
kvv77 [185]
The site of the chernobyl nuclear accident in 1986, was at the Chernobyl Nuclear Power Plant, which was located in Ukraine. In terms of cost and casualties, it was the worst nuclear power plant disaster in history.
